one gallery
"Plants_001"  (2003) by Eduardo
  • poolshade poolshade
from $ 17
  • Peppers Peppers
from $ 17
  • Flowers_001 Flowers_001
from $ 17
  • Plants_001 Plants_001
from $ 17

Discover gorgeous Fine art prints. Fast and reliable shipping. 100% satisfaction guarantee.